Details
-
New Feature
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
None
-
None
-
None
Description
Currently, UUID columns can be selected or even filtered if a table containing such a column is created not by the Calcite-based SQL engine (for example via cache API using @QuerySqlField field annotation).
But we cannot use it in DDL:
CREATE TABLE t (id UUID)
Or cast:
SELECT CAST(id AS UUID)
Attachments
Issue Links
- Blocked
-
IGNITE-18415 SQL. Cannot use UUID class as parameters for query
- Resolved
- blocks
-
IGNITE-15436 Calcite engine. Merge Calcite SQL Engine to Ignite 2.x
- Resolved
- is blocked by
-
IGNITE-16376 Sql. Add UUID custom data type.
- Resolved
- is part of
-
IGNITE-12248 Apache Calcite based query execution engine
- Open
- links to
(1 links to)